Apple, Google add support for Thread 1.4

Apple and Google are updating their smart home streaming devices to Thread 1.4. As first spotted by Matter Alpha and 9to5 Google, the latest spec has arrived on compatible Apple TVs in the tvOS 27 dev beta and the Google TV Streamer through a software update.

This lays the groundwork for these devices, which serve as Thread Border Routers, to implement Thread credential sharing, enabling them to connect more easily to an existing Thread network rather than creating their own.
